It provides the low-level classes needed to construct and manage HyperDrive runs\u2014Azure's service for automated hyperparameter optimization\u2014when used alongside azureml-train-core. The package is built on standard HTTP clients (requests, msrest, msrestazure) to communicate with Azure ML's remote services.\n\nThis is a specialized component within the broader Azure ML SDK, not a standalone tool. It is typically installed as a dependency of higher-level Azure ML packages or when you need direct control over HyperDrive run configuration.
